Fill a cocktail shaker with ice. Add light rum, dark rum, passion fruit juice, orange juice, fresh lime juice, simple syrup, and grenadine to the cocktail shaker. Shake the cocktail shaker vigorously for about 10-15 seconds to mix the ingredients well. Fill a Hurricane glass with crushed ice. Strain the cocktail into the glass.

Slowly pour the grenadine ...The original hurricane cocktail was said to have consisted of nothing but rum, lemon juice, and the hard-to-come-by Fassionola. Fassionola was a sweet syrup with passionfruit and other fruit flavors. In a 24 oz Hurricane glass, ...The Hurricane cocktail is a creation of Pat O’Brien’s Bar (originally Mr. O’Brien’s Club Tipperary), founded in 1933 by its eponymous owner in New Orleans’s French Quarter.
